Work on the flare
Arrive slow and the sink rate at the threshold is already above schedule, the flare is short because there is no energy to extend it, and the touchdown is hard in a way that feels exactly like a late flare. Diagnosing a slow arrival as a late flare is the catastrophic misread: you respond by flaring earlier, which bleeds more speed, which makes the next one worse. The tiebreaker is threshold speed against VRef, not feel. Never diagnose a flare without it.

The flight began with a departure roll from runway 27R at Gillespie Field, KSEE. The Beechcraft Baron G58 took off with a takeoff distance of 766 feet, which accounted for 17% of the runway. The liftoff speed was 103 knots, and the aircraft climbed away from the airport.
As the aircraft climbed to a higher altitude, it encountered local weather conditions with a temperature of 78 degrees Fahrenheit and a wind speed of 14 knots from a direction of 268 degrees. This resulted in a 3-knot crosswind and a 14-knot headwind. The aircraft continued its climb, passing overhead Santee, California, and reaching an altitude of 4,242 feet above sea level.
After reaching the desired altitude, the aircraft began its enroute descent, starting 3 miles west of Eucalyptus Hills, California. The descent was from 4,767 feet above sea level to 1,510 feet above sea level, a decrease of 3,257 feet in 2 minutes, covering a distance of 2 nautical miles.
The final approach to runway 24R at Miramar Marine Corps Air Station - Mitscher Field, KNKX, was from the east, heading 260 degrees at a distance of 4 nautical miles and an altitude of 1,058 feet above ground level. However, the aircraft was required to execute a go-around due to the aircraft's position.
The go-around was initiated at an altitude of 1,035 feet above ground level. After completing the go-around, the aircraft made a successful landing on runway 24R, which had a length of 11,982 feet. The threshold height at 85 feet above ground level was significantly above the target, and the threshold speed was well above the target at 94 knots.
The touchdown point was 1,191 feet beyond the touchdown zone, with a touchdown speed of 73 knots, which was good. The touchdown rate was fair at -270 feet per minute. The runway touchdown position was misaligned by 33 feet from the centerline. The local weather conditions during the landing were a temperature of 71 degrees Fahrenheit and a wind speed of 15 knots from a direction of 271 degrees, resulting in a 4-knot crosswind and a 14-knot headwind.
The total landing distance was 3,403 feet, which accounted for 28% of the runway. The runway rollout alignment was very good. After landing, the aircraft taxied to the parking area from the runway, taking 1 minute and covering less than 1 nautical mile.
The total flight distance was 10 nautical miles, and the flight duration was 8 minutes. The aircraft used 11 pounds of fuel during the flight.
